The REVODATA Gigabit Type C PoE Splitter converts 48V Power over Ethernet into a stable 5V/2.4A USB-C output, supporting up to 12W power delivery. It delivers true gigabit speeds (1000Mbps) for seamless data transmission and features plug-and-play installation with multiple built-in protections. Ideal for powering non-PoE devices like Raspberry Pi and smart home gadgets without extra adapters, it complies with IEEE 802.3af standards and ensures reliable, clutter-free connectivity.

S**M
Works perfectly for Openreach ONT
I have an Openreach Fibre ONT (modem) where the ducting comes into my property downstairs, however all of my network and server gear is in the upstairs cupboard including my battery backup. This PoE splitter means that, with an appropriate PoE injector upstairs on the WAN port of my router, I can run the ONT off my battery backup upstairs, so in the event of a power cut I continue to be connected to the exchange. The barrel jack and the voltage/power output are absolutely perfect for the Openreach ONT and work flawlessly, plus this frees up a socket downstairs!
A**R
PoE to USB-C only — no PoE passthrough on Ethernet.
Just in case this helps anyone: the USB-C port delivers power, but the Ethernet port does not. I had assumed the PoE power would be split between USB-C and Ethernet. My goal was to power a PoE camera and an SDI converter from the same device, but unfortunately that didn’t work. That said, the product does function as advertised for USB-C power delivery — it successfully triggers fast charging on my phone.
